Articles of mysql

insérer des données d’une table à une autre dans mysql

Je veux lire toutes les données d’une table et insérer des données dans une autre table. ma requête est INSERT INTO mt_magazine_subscription ( magazine_subscription_id, subscription_name, magazine_id, status ) VALUES ( (SELECT magazine_subscription_id, subscription_name, magazine_id FROM tbl_magazine_subscription ORDER BY magazine_subscription_id ASC), ‘1’) mais j’ai une erreur qui #1136 – Column count doesn’t match value count at […]

mysqldump n’exporte qu’une seule table

J’utilisais mysqldump pour exporter la firebase database, comme ceci: mysqldump -u root -ppassword my_database > c:\temp\my_database.sql D’une certaine manière, il n’exporte qu’une seule table. Y a-t-il quelque chose que je fais mal?

Pouvez-vous définir des tables «littérales» en SQL?

Existe-t-il une syntaxe de sous–requête SQL permettant de définir, littéralement, une table temporaire? Par exemple, quelque chose comme SELECT MAX(count) AS max, COUNT(*) AS count FROM ( (1 AS id, 7 AS count), (2, 6), (3, 13), (4, 12), (5, 9) ) AS mytable INNER JOIN someothertable ON someothertable.id=mytable.id Cela éviterait de devoir faire deux […]

Création de tables et de problèmes avec la clé primaire dans Rails

Lorsque j’essaie d’exécuter le code suivant dans Rails en utilisant Mysql2 en tant que gestionnaire de firebase database: rake db:migrate J’obtiens l’erreur suivante: rake aborted! “Mysql2::Error: All parts of a PRIMARY KEY must be NOT NULL:” Pourquoi est-ce que j’obtiens cette erreur si la clé primaire d’une table par défaut n’est PAS “null”? Code de […]

Comment sélectionner compte avec le créateur de requêtes courant de Laravel?

Voici ma requête utilisant un générateur de requêtes fluide. $query = DB::table(‘category_issue’) ->select(‘issues.*’) ->where(‘category_id’, ‘=’, 1) ->join(‘issues’, ‘category_issue.issue_id’, ‘=’, ‘issues.id’) ->left_join(‘issue_subscriptions’, ‘issues.id’, ‘=’, ‘issue_subscriptions.issue_id’) ->group_by(‘issues.id’) ->order_by(DB::raw(‘COUNT(issue_subscriptions.issue_id)’), ‘desc’) ->get(); Comme vous pouvez le voir, je commande par un compte de la table jointe. Cela fonctionne bien. Cependant, je veux que ce compte soit retourné avec mes […]

Joomla! 3 installation gèle lors de la création de la table de firebase database

J’essaie d’installer Joomla! 3.2.1 sur mon système mais l’installation se fige à mi-chemin. J’ai téléchargé et installé le Wamp Server 2.4 et je voulais installer localement Joomla! 3.2.1, mais l’installation se fige et ne se termine pas. Il ne s’arrête pas à la fin de l’installation lors de la tâche “créer des tables de firebase […]

MySQL LEFT JOIN 3 tables

J’ai 3 tables: Personnes (PersonID, Nom, SS) Les peurs (craint, peur) Person_Fear (ID, PersonID, FearID) Maintenant, je voudrais énumérer chaque personne avec la peur qui lui est liée (peut être de multiples peurs mais peut aussi être aucune). La table des personnes doit être affichée même si une personne n’y a pas de peur. Je […]

MySQL «ERROR 1005 (HY000): Impossible de créer la table foo. # Sql-12c_4» (errno: 150) »

Je travaillais sur la création de tables dans la firebase database foo , mais chaque fois que je me retrouve avec errno 150 concernant la clé étrangère. Tout d’abord, voici mon code pour créer des tables: CREATE TABLE Clients ( client_id CHAR(10) NOT NULL , client_name CHAR(50) NOT NULL , provisional_license_num CHAR(50) NOT NULL , […]

MySQL Multiple Left Joins

J’essaie de créer une page de nouvelles pour un site Web sur lequel je travaille. J’ai décidé d’utiliser les requêtes MySQL correctes (c’est-à-dire COUNT (id) et les jointures au lieu de plusieurs requêtes ou num_rows). J’utilise un wrapper PDO qui devrait fonctionner correctement, et qui échoue quand il est exécuté directement via Application MySQL CLI. […]

Tout sélectionner où

Ceci est une question de suivi à mon précédent. Je veux écrire des instructions mysql qui font écho à chaque entrée commençant par la lettre B. Fonction.php function getCategory() { $query = mysql_query(“SELECT author FROM lyrics WHERE author [starts with letter B]”) or die(mysql_error()); while ($row = mysql_fetch_assoc($query)) { ?> <?php } Category.php? Category = […]